Munchkin: Sheep Impact! Singularity Help
Hello,
So this has happened twice while playing with sheep impact. A player dies on their turn and once the next player starts their turn a seal happens to open and it is singularity. My question is does the player who died take the effects of singularity and draw 4 cards of each or can he not draw any cards until it is his turn again. This was up for discussion because the wording im the rules states that the player reappears again when the next player starts their turn but also states that they cant receive any cards. Any help would be greatly appreciated. |

Re: Munchkin: Sheep Impact! Singularity Help
The timing is critical here.
If the Singularity hits while you are actually dead (for instance, if your death was the reason that Seal opened), the "dead characters don't get cards" rule overrides the Singularity, and you don't draw any cards. Remember, however, that you only stay dead until the next player's turn starts. So if you died, dealt with that aftermath, and then another turn started, you aren't dead anymore and you can get cards just like anyone else. You just don't happen to HAVE any cards at the moment. If the Singularity occurs after you have come back to life but before you have drawn a new hand (per the Death rules), then you draw a new hand because of the Singularity effects and then draw eight MORE cards because of the Death rules. You've found a very entertaining loophole!
